What is International Compost Week (ICAW)? It is the largest and most comprehensive education initiative of the compost industry. It is celebrated each year in the first full week of May. To maximize the benefits of clean energy development, Governor Brown of California has called for 12,000 megawatts of clean local energy to be installed in California communities by 2020. 1) Sonoco Recycling and Boeing have announced a partnership to to dramatically reduce waste and divert materials from landfills. The program at the Boeing Dreamliner final assembly facility in South Carolina, is focused on finding alternative uses for the materials that could result in new revenue streams.
